The character was inspired by the real-life mayor of Moerbeke, Jean Mariën. Much like Meneer Pheip he too owned a local sugar factory, had a moustache and was short and obese. Some sources claim Maurice Lippens was the main inspiration.

Adhemar taught Pheip Dutch twice, failing in "De Groene Gravin" ("The Green Duchess") (1975), but succeeding in "Het Spook van Zoetendaal" ("The Ghost of Zoetendaal") (1980-1981) where Adhemar advised him to read "Taalwenken" by Marc Galle. Because Pheip once again forgets everything he learned by the next story Adhemar teaches him again, with success, in "De Indiaanse Neusfluit" ("The Indian Nose Flute") (1987), but once again Pheip returns to his old, familiar language again by the end of the next story. Pheip's combination of Dutch and French can be seen as a satirical take on "franskiljons".
